Am I not cut out for driving?

2 replies

Houseofvelour · 18/07/2021 20:37

I've recently started learning to drive. I've had 7 double lessons so far and my test is booked for mid august.

No matter what I do, I always drive too close to the left, I drift in the road but I honestly can't tell that I'm drifting and to me it looks like I'm driving in a straight line and my focus isn't great.
Today I was driving with DH in the car and I was glancing at the speedometer when DH shouted and when I looked up, I was about to crash into a parked car.
I honestly feel like I'm never going to be a competent and confident driver.

Has anyone else been absolutely shit in the beginning and now a master on the roads?

Have you had an eye test? When I first took lessons, my instructor got me to sit in the passenger seat and he said he was going to drive how I drove. He had the car drifting. I usually wear glasses for reading etc. Became apparent I needed them for driving too. The looking at speedometer thing is something that comes with experience, knowing how quickly to glance. Lots of luck.
